This book delves into the ecological intricacies of the St. Floris National Park, a realm of diverse landscapes and abundant wildlife nestled within the Central African Republic. The author's meticulous research, conducted during the late 1970s, unveils the park's captivating tapestry of flora and fauna, encompassing a spectrum of habitats from lush savannas to seasonally flooded plains. The narrative traces the park's historical significance, shaped by its location on the Islamic frontier and the enduring impact of slave raiding during the 19th and early 20th centuries. The author's insights extend beyond the park's boundaries, exploring the intricate relationship between human populations and the delicate ecosystem they inhabit. The book's thematic depth lies in its exploration of the challenges and opportunities facing St. Floris. It delves into the complexities of conservation, addressing issues such as poaching, habitat management, and the delicate balance between tourism and ecological preservation. The author's recommendations for future management and research initiatives underscore the importance of sustainable practices in safeguarding this invaluable natural treasure for generations to come.
